Two - Goal Hero Simeon Tochukwu Nwankwo Happy With Performance Against Sporting Covilha
Published: August 24, 2015
Simeon Tochukwu Nwankwo helped himself to two goals as Gil Vicente thrashed Sporting Covilhã 4 - 0 in the Portuguese Segunda Liga on Sunday.
It is still too early to talk about Gil Vicente’s promotion chances three matches into the season but they are already playing catch - up on Atlético CP , who are five points above them.
“ It was a strong performance from the team and a well deserved win, ” Nwankwo said to allnigeriasoccer.com.
“ It is a different league with lots of young players and new new coach. Still in the stage of adaptation to the coaches ideas.
“ We are getting better in every game so I believe we are on the right track.”
The Gil Vicente number 99 is in the final year of his contract with the Estádio Cidade de Barcelos outfit.
